The challenge for this week is “Be Generous in Your Giving”.

This is part of a yearly series “Weekly Challenges to Get Closer to God”.  There are 26 challenges for 1 year. So, you prayerfully concentrate on 1 task for 1 week (every other week) and see what happens.

Being generous in your giving has many forms.  It can be giving of your time, services, encouragement, knowledge, kindness, and yes – monetary.  You can’t give what you do not have.  But we all have something to give.

We should give with a cheerful heart.  It really is better to give than to receive.  It can fill you with joy.  However, don’t give so you will look good or feel better.  Don’t make it a selfish thing.

So for one week, be more generous than usual in your giving.    Prayerfully give with a cheerful heart all week.   And see what happens.  See how you get closer to God.

Here are some Bible verses to motivate you.

2 Corinthians 9:7-9    Each of you should give what you have decided in your heart to give, not reluctantly or under compulsion, for God loves a cheerful giver.   And God is able to bless you abundantly, so that in all things at all times, having all that you need, you will abound in every good work.   As it is written: “They have freely scattered their gifts to the poor; their righteousness endures forever.”

Luke 6:38  Give, and it will be given to you. A good measure, pressed down, shaken together and running over, will be poured into your lap. For with the measure you use, it will be measured to you.”

Proverbs 11:24-25  One person gives freely, yet gains even more; another withholds unduly, but comes to poverty.  A generous person will prosper; whoever refreshes others will be refreshed.

Proverbs 19:17  Whoever is kind to the poor lends to the LORD, and he will reward them for what they have done.

Acts 20:35    In everything I did, I showed you that by this kind of hard work we must help the weak, remembering the words the Lord Jesus himself said: ‘It is more blessed to give than to receive.’ ”
